Property sold in execution - Interest is recoverable till date of confirmation.
Citation
AIR 1919 ALLAHABAD 253
ALLAHABAD HIGH COURT
PIGGOTT , J. and WALSH , J.
Execution First Appeal No. 72 of 1918, against decision of Addl. Sub-Judge, Moradabad, D/- 26th
January 1918, Decided on D/- 11 - 3 - 1919
Khalilulrahman v. Gokul Chand
Interest - Decree awarding interest till realization - Property sold in execution - Interest is
recoverable till date of confirmation.
Where property is sold in execution of a decree, which awards interest until realization, the decree-
holder is entitled to interest for the period intervening between the date of the sale and the date of
confirmation of the sale.
